Sony CEO Vows to Save Struggling Xperia Brand

Sony CFO Lin Tao has signaled the company’s commitment to reviving its struggling mobile brand, Xperia. Despite declining market share and increased competition, Tao emphasized the importance of communication technology as a core capability for Sony. The brand’s premium pricing is a major issue, with devices like the Xperia 1 VII often selling for over ¥200,000 (around €1,500). To escape its niche trap, Sony must address software polish, pricing, and broader appeal. The company’s recent suspension of sales in global markets and replacement program may have damaged consumer trust, but it has not yet determined the fate of Xperia.
